Abstract: This guide is intended to help schools develop linkages with the federal Medicaid program, particularly the Early and Periodic, Screening, Diagnostic, and Treatment (EPSDT) program, a comprehensive and preventive health care system for Medicaid-eligible individuals up to age 21. The guide aims to: (1) acquaint schools with State Medicaid agencies and the EPSDT program; (2) discuss how schools can develop or augment EPSDT outreach and health service programs; (3) direct schools to additional sources of information; and (4) illustrate some different types of linkages between schools and the EPSDT program. Chapter 1 introduces the EPSDT program, while chapter 2 describes the program in more detail and outlines the services that the program provides. Chapters 3 and 4 focus on school roles in EPSDT, including outreach case management and service delivery. Chapter 5 reviews examples of successful partnerships between local educational systems and EPSDT programs, and highlights the school's role in conducting outreach activities, screening, and providing a full range of services. Two appendixes provide lists of regional and state contact persons and agencies at the federal and state level that help administer the EPSDT program. (MDM)
